Pride health is seeking a qualified Registered Dietitian (RD) to provide comprehensive medical nutrition therapy, nutrition care, and preventive counseling across an acute care setting in Bemidji, MN, 56601
.
. The dietitian will assess nutritional status, develop individualized nutrition care plans, implement evidence-based interventions, educate patients and healthcare teams, and monitor outcomes for patients across the lifespan.
Key Responsibilities- Provide medical nutrition therapy and comprehensive nutrition care to patients of all ages, including neonatal, pediatric, adolescent, adult, and geriatric populations, as assigned.
- Conduct thorough nutritional assessments and determine individualized nutrition needs.
- Develop and implement individualized nutrition care plans based on clinical condition, nutritional status, and identified risks.
- Recommend and implement appropriate nutrition therapies, including diet modifications, nutrition support, oral nutrition supplements, and provider order recommendations.
- Provide nutrition education and counseling related to disease management, medical conditions, health risks, and preventive care.
- Support patient self-management education and skills for individuals with chronic conditions.
- Evaluate the effectiveness of nutrition interventions and treatments using an evidence-based approach.
- Consider patients' cultural, ethnic, and religious beliefs when developing nutrition interventions.
- Collaborate with physicians, nurses, and other members of the healthcare team to optimize patient outcomes.
- Participate in the development and implementation of nutrition care protocols for the assigned area.
- Serve as a clinical resource and leader for the healthcare team regarding nutrition therapies.
- Monitor patient progress and evaluate outcomes of medical nutrition therapy interventions.
- Provide education regarding appropriate diets based on disease state, medical condition, and health risk.
- Maintain accurate and timely documentation in the EPIC electronic medical record.
- Bachelor's degree in Dietetics, Food and Nutrition, or a related field through an ACEND-accredited program
. - For individuals qualifying to take the registration examination after January 1, 2024, a master's degree is required under current ACEND/CDR eligibility requirements.
- Completion of clinical nutrition experience through an approved coordinated undergraduate program or successful completion of a postgraduate dietetic internship.
- Current Registered Dietitian (RD) credential through the Commission on Dietetic Registration (CDR).
- Strong clinical nutrition assessment, counseling, and care-planning skills.
- Ability to work effectively with patients across diverse age groups and backgrounds.
- Excellent communication, documentation, and interdisciplinary collaboration skills
